A Professional Certificate in IoT for Building Controls equips you with the practical skills and theoretical knowledge to design, implement, and manage Internet of Things (IoT) solutions within building automation systems. This intensive program focuses on leveraging IoT technologies for enhanced building efficiency and control.
Learning outcomes include mastering the fundamentals of IoT architectures, understanding various building control systems and protocols (like BACnet, Modbus), gaining hands-on experience with IoT sensors and actuators, and developing proficiency in data analytics for optimizing building performance. You will also learn about cybersecurity best practices crucial for protecting IoT devices within a building environment.
